Comment: arXiv admin note: substantial text overlap with arXiv:1912.00211Since the 1990s, AI systems have achieved superhuman performance in major zero-sum games where "winning" has an unambiguous definition. However, most social interactions are mixed-motive games, where measuring the performance of AI systems is a non-trivial task. In this paper, I propose a novel benchmark called super-Nash performance to assess the performance of AI systems in mixed-motive settings. I show that a solution concept called optimin achieves super-Nash performance in every n-person game, i.e., for every Nash equilibrium there exists an optimin where every player not only receives but also guarantees super-Nash payoffs even if the others deviate unilaterally and profitably from the optimin.
